Grub screw with cone point M5×5 mm DIN 914 stainless steel A2

Grub screw with cone point M5×5 DIN 914 is a precision mounting element made from stainless steel A2 (AISI 304), designed for applications requiring durable and corrosion-resistant clamping connections. The conical end of the screw ensures point contact with the surface, guaranteeing secure position setting of connected elements — particularly important when mounting balustrades, handrails and structural hardware made from stainless steel.
The hexagon socket (Allen key) allows for convenient and quick installation using a standard Allen key. The small dimensions of the screw allow for use in locations with limited mounting space, and execution in accordance with DIN 914 standard ensures full interchangeability and repeatability in installation series.
Technical specification
- Type: grub screw with cone point
- Thread: M5
- Length (L): 5 mm
- Socket: hexagon socket (Allen key)
- Standard: DIN 914
- Material: stainless steel A2 (AISI 304)
- Weight: 0.004 kg
Application
The DIN 914 grub screw finds wide application as a positioning and locking element in stainless steel constructions. It performs excellently in balustrade mounting, handles, pipe fittings and handrail elements. The conical end embeds into the component surface, creating a secure connection resistant to vibrations and oscillations. Stainless steel A2 guarantees corrosion resistance — both in internal applications and on the exterior of buildings.
